The phrase "extent required" is correct and commonly used in written English.
It is typically used to refer to the amount or degree of something that is necessary or needed in a particular situation. Example: "The employee is expected to work overtime to the extent required to complete the project on time." In this example, "extent required" refers to the extent or amount of overtime that is necessary to finish the project within the specified time frame. It could also be used in a legal context, such as "The company is liable for damages to the extent required by law."
